Battenberg
Battenberg (population 5,421, as of June 2011) towers on top of a hill above the Eder River. Many attractions, such as the Visitors’ Mine, the half-timbered City Hall, and the Hunting Castle are worthy of a trip.

Frankenberg
Frankenberg with a population of 18,729 (as of June 2011) is the largest town in the vacation region of Ederbergland.
